The Professional Certificate in Lean Six Sigma for Safety Engineers equips professionals with advanced skills to enhance workplace safety and operational efficiency. This program focuses on integrating Lean Six Sigma methodologies with safety engineering principles to reduce risks and improve processes.
Key learning outcomes include mastering Lean Six Sigma tools like DMAIC (Define, Measure, Analyze, Improve, Control), identifying safety hazards, and implementing data-driven solutions. Participants will also learn to streamline workflows, minimize waste, and foster a culture of continuous improvement in safety management.
